From ae155060247be8dcae3802a95bd1bdf93ab3215d Mon Sep 17 00:00:00 2001 From: Paolo Abeni pabeni@redhat.com Date: Tue, 18 Nov 2025 08:20:24 +0100 Subject: [PATCH] mptcp: fix duplicate reset on fastclose
The CI reports sporadic failures of the fastclose self-tests. The root cause is a duplicate reset, not carrying the relevant MPTCP option. In the failing scenario the bad reset is received by the peer before the fastclose one, preventing the reception of the latter.
Indeed there is window of opportunity at fastclose time for the following race:
mptcp_do_fastclose __mptcp_close_ssk __tcp_close() tcp_set_state() [1] tcp_send_active_reset() [2]
After [1] the stack will send reset to in-flight data reaching the now closed port. Such reset may race with [2].
Address the issue explicitly sending a single reset on fastclose before explicitly moving the subflow to close status.

Signed-off-by: Jakub Kicinski kuba@kernel.org [ Conflicts in protocol.c, because commit bbd49d114d57 ("mptcp: consolidate transition to TCP_CLOSE in mptcp_do_fastclose()") is not in this version. It introduced a new line in the context. The same modification can still be applied. Also, tcp_send_active_reset() doesn't take a 3rd argument (sk_rst_reason) in this version, see commit 5691276b39da ("rstreason: prepare for active reset"). This argument is only helpful for tracing, it is fine to drop it. ] Signed-off-by: Matthieu Baerts (NGI0) matttbe@kernel.org --- net/mptcp/protocol.c | 34 +++++++++++++++++++++------------- 1 file changed, 21 insertions(+), 13 deletions(-)
